Collingwood HBADP Lentus DALI to PWM Converter for One Driver
Product DescriptionThe HBADP is a non-isolated signal converter, transforming the DALI signal to PWM signal. It conforms to the DALI protocol IEC 63286-101, 102, 103, 207. Its input voltage ranges from 10Vdc to 22.5Vdc. One converter can control one LED driver with strong output PWM signal. It flexibly fits in many different DALI lighting system designs.
-
Features & Benefits
- A converter to transform the DALI signal to PWM signal for one LED driver
- Input DALI dimming signal, Output PWM dimming signal
- Dimming range 10%-100% (Dim to OFF)
- Default is set to 100% maximum output
- Logarithmic and linear dimming modes can be selected via DALI interface
- DALI protocol can accommodate 16 x groups and 64 x IP addresses
- IP67 waterproof casing
